Steering lock unit failed. Had a key emblem the night before, thought it was maybe a fob battery issue. Next morning vehicle would not start or go into accessory position. Researched and found the common steering lock unit issue. Had it towed to dealership, and sure enough the unit had failed. Replaced part out of pocket, as the issue was covered for 2009 and first half 2010 cars with similar issues. Mine is a second half 2010 so no coverage.

Steering lock relay failed and caused wheel to remain locked (car will not start). Cost over $1,000 after labor and tow. Widely documented issue on many websites and car forums (the370z. Com). Also, issue has been addressed by Nissan for the gt-r and even removed this steering lock from newer 2011 models, and all 2012 and 2013.
